Since 2005, Minneapolis Mayhem Rugby has strived to be a club that promotes participation in rugby by traditionally underrepresented groups, including gay/bi men and trans people. We provide an inclusive environment in which members of diverse communities can learn the laws and practice of rugby and have the opportunity to compete at local, regional, national, and international venues. Mayhem Rugby develops the sport of rugby for
all regardless of their age, gender, or sexuality to reduce barriers and create a more inclusive sport for all.
Mayhem Rugby is a member of
International Gay Rugby. We primarily play rugby with other members of IGR and local non-IGR teams. We compete in the biennial Mark Kendall Bingham Memorial Tournament, or
Bingham Cup. Minneapolis hosted the Bingham Cup in 2010.
